Output 502d132250c317f666ac8efb3640d760c3998e207c8847a0e4eb8c546c65d1a3:0

value
103366812
script pubkey
OP_0 OP_PUSHBYTES_20 3bb5a8520e6ba104c48acdb79c94bc6b2639bda0
address
bc1q8w66s5swdwssf3y2ekmee99udvnrn0dqrzq87w
transaction
502d132250c317f666ac8efb3640d760c3998e207c8847a0e4eb8c546c65d1a3
spent
true